Why Laser Cutting Plexiglass is a Game-Changer

Introduction

Plexiglass, also known as acrylic glass or PMMA (polymethyl methacrylate), has become increasingly popular in various industries due to its versatility and durability. Traditionally, cutting plexiglass involved using saws or other mechanical tools, which often resulted in rough edges and limitations on intricate designs. However, the emergence of laser cutting technology has revolutionized the way plexiglass is cut, providing a precise and efficient alternative that has propelled the material to new heights.

The Advantages of Laser Cutting Plexiglass

Laser cutting plexiglass offers a multitude of advantages over traditional cutting methods. Here are some of the key reasons why it is considered a game-changer:

Precision and Intricacy

One of the standout features of laser cutting is its exceptional precision and ability to create intricate designs with ease. The focused laser beam vaporizes the material, resulting in clean edges and smooth finishes. This level of precision opens up a world of possibilities for designers, allowing them to create complex and detailed shapes that were previously unattainable. Whether it’s intricate patterns, detailed logos, or precisely cut parts, laser cutting plexiglass can bring any design to life.

Fast and Efficient

Laser cutting is incredibly fast and efficient compared to traditional cutting methods. The laser beam moves swiftly across the plexiglass, cutting through it effortlessly and reducing the production time significantly. This speed and efficiency not only save valuable time but also contribute to cost savings, making it a cost-effective solution for businesses.

Smooth and Polished Edges

Unlike traditional cutting methods that leave rough edges that require additional sanding or finishing, laser cutting plexiglass produces clean and polished edges. The laser beam melts and fuses the material as it cuts, resulting in a smooth and consistent finish. This eliminates the need for manual post-processing, reducing labor and ensuring a flawless final product.

Versatility

Laser cutting machines are incredibly versatile and can cut plexiglass of varying thicknesses and sizes, adapting to the needs of different projects. Whether it’s thin sheets or thicker blocks, the laser can handle them all. This versatility allows for flexibility in design choices and opens up opportunities for a wide range of applications in industries such as signage, furniture, electronics, automotive, and more.

FAQs about Laser Cutting Plexiglass

1. Is laser cutting safe for plexiglass?

Yes, laser cutting plexiglass is safe when proper precautions are taken. It is essential to use the correct laser power settings and adequate ventilation to prevent the material from melting or releasing harmful fumes. Following safety guidelines and operating the laser cutting machine correctly ensures a safe cutting environment.

2. What is the maximum thickness of plexiglass that can be laser cut?

The maximum thickness of plexiglass that can be laser cut depends on the specific laser cutting machine. However, most machines can cut through plexiglass sheets up to 1 inch (25mm) thick. For thicker blocks, other cutting methods like multiple passes or alternative tools may be required.

3. Can laser cutting create engraved designs on plexiglass?

Laser cutting machines are not only capable of cutting through plexiglass but also engraving intricate designs on its surface. By adjusting the laser power and speed, it is possible to create detailed engravings, adding a unique touch to plexiglass products.

4. Are there any design limitations when laser cutting plexiglass?

Laser cutting significantly reduces design limitations compared to traditional cutting methods. However, it is important to consider factors such as the heat generated during the cutting process, kerf width (material lost during cutting), and the need for support structures in intricate designs. Consulting with a laser cutting professional or conducting tests beforehand can help determine the best approach for a particular design.

5. Can laser cutting be used on other materials besides plexiglass?

Yes, laser cutting is commonly used on various materials, including wood, paper, fabric, metal, and even some types of stone. The versatility of laser cutting machines allows for a wide range of applications across different industries.
